Abstract | ||
---|---|---|
A number of packages have recently been developed to enable the execution of MATLAB programs on parallel processors. For many applications, an integrated load balancing functionality is also necessary to realize the full benefits of parallelization. This paper describes a toolkit based on MatlabMPI to ease the parallelization and integration of load balancing into MATLAB applications that contain computationally-intensive loops with independent iterations. Modifications to existing code to incorporate the toolkit are minimal. Performance tests of two nontrivial MATLAB programs with the toolkit on a general-purpose Linux cluster indicate that significant speedups are achievable. |
Year | DOI | Venue |
---|---|---|
2006 | 10.1007/11758525_58 | International Conference on Computational Science (2) |
Keywords | Field | DocType |
load balance,linux cluster | Software tool,MATLAB,Computer science,Load balancing (computing),Dynamic load testing,Parallel computing,Dynamic load balancing,Computer cluster | Conference |
Volume | ISSN | ISBN |
3992 | 0302-9743 | 3-540-34381-4 |
Citations | PageRank | References |
1 | 0.35 | 10 |
Authors | ||
3 |
Name | Order | Citations | PageRank |
---|---|---|---|
Ricolindo Cariño | 1 | 33 | 4.19 |
Ioana Banicescu | 2 | 395 | 39.18 |
Wenzhong Gao | 3 | 166 | 18.82 |